The integrated crank system allows you to easily and smoothly open or adjust the louvres. Open it right up and enjoy that perfect Kiwi summers day or keep it closed when the weather is changeable - the integrated gutters and internal downpipes make this roof system truly all-weather.

The crisp charcoal powder coat finish and contemporary style blends well with most outdoor areas, while the straightforward instructions make this a great DIY upgrade. The built-in gutters feature hidden outlets through the foot of each pole, letting the water disperse without the need for ugly pipework everywhere.

With its strong aluminium frame, louvres and galvanised fittings this roof system is built to last, while being easy to clean and maintain.

Each bank of louvres is operated by a separate gear crank system, so you really can tailor the shade to your needs. Keep one half cool and shady, then open the other side to vent the BBQ.

☆ Note on accessory compatibility: Blinds are compatible with existing 6x4m and 6x3m Louvre Roof Systems on all sides and shutters panels can be positioned anywhere as both these models feature centrally mounted cranks. Both accessories replace the corner bracket during installation. For 4m sides (3.7m post to post) use a single 3.7m blind or up three 1.23m shutters. For 3m sides (2.7m post to post), use a single 2.7m blind or up to three 0.9m shutters. Treat 6m long sides as 2 x 3m sides for blinds & shutters. See images above for more details.

SPECIFICATIONS
Total dimensions: W 5.780m x D 3.958m x H 2.3m
Frame material: Aluminium, 2.0mm (beam) / 1.6mm (post)
Louvre panel material: Aluminium, 1.4mm
Top beam dimensions (each): W 45mm (horizontal) x H 120mm (vertical)
Colour: Charcoal powder coat
Post dimensions: 230cm x 10cm x 10cm
Louvre dimensions: L 135.4cm x W 14.5cm
Ground plate dimensions: 16cm x 16cm
Weight net/gross: 279/331kg

Q:
How long would it take and the recommended number of people to assemble the 6M X 4M model?
A:
From previous customer feedback, we would say it takes 2 people approx 4-6 hours.

Q:
Can you put these side by side to make 8m x 6m? Cheers
A:
Yes, these can sit side by side, you will need to trim the base plates to make them flush. You might want to add flashing in-between too so water doesn't get between the units.

Q:
Are they totally waterproof when the lourves are closed?
A:
Under normal conditions these are designed to be weathertight, high winds could cause some flexing causing momentary gaps, blocked gutters, abnormal levels of rain could result in standing water that could seep through. But generally they will be watertight.

Q:
How does this system withstand very high wind zones? Where we live, we experiencing wind gusts up to 50km. Thank you.
A:
The Louvre is not rated to be in very high wind zones, they have been wind tested to 75km/h in direct winds. Being near to a house or other structures helps to break up the strength of wind gusts.
